The Eustachian tube gets swollen shut (edema) or blocked by thick mucus. When this happens, air cannot get into the middle ear. The existing air in the ear gets absorbed by the body, creating a vacuum. This vacuum sucks the eardrum inward, causing that sensation of fullness, pressure, and hearing loss.
